What to check before for buildings with rent-stabilized apartments near Bronx Academy of Health Careers in NYC

  • Confirm the unit’s exact rent-stabilized status on the lease and any renewal paperwork, since eligibility can be unit-specific.
  • Compare the full monthly cost (rent plus typical move-in items like deposits and any required fees). The asking rent is only part of what you’ll pay.
  • Use Openigloo’s tenant Q&A and building notes to flag practical issues (maintenance responsiveness, common charges, package/entry rules) before you apply.
  • When you’re shortlisting, check lease start dates, renewal timelines, and any documented constraints that could affect your move-in plan.
  • If a building shows an apartment currently available, verify what’s included (utilities, services) and whether there are additional building fees listed for residents.
